
◆排序算法
(1)插入类排序
▲直接插入排序
▲折半插入排序
▲希尔排序
(2)交换类排序
▲冒泡排序 最坏情况下的比较次数n(n-1)/2
▲快速排序 最坏情况下的比较次数n(n-1)/2
(3)选择类排序
例题精选:
1. 设一棵完全二叉树共有699个结点,则在该二叉树中的叶子结点数为:350
2. 已知二叉树后序遍历序列是dabec,中序遍历序列是debac,它的前序遍历序列为:cedba
3. 要求内存量的是:归并排序
4. 在数据结构中,与所使用的计算机无关的是数据的是:逻辑结构
5. 栈底至栈顶依次存放元素A.B.C.D,在第五个元素E入栈前,栈中元素可以出栈,则出栈序列可能是:DCBEA
6. 已知数据表A 中每个元素距其最终位置不远,为节省时间,应采取的算法是:直接插入排序
7. 用链式表示线性表的优点是:便于插入和删除操作。
正在阅读:
2017年计算机二级公共基础知识重点讲解:数据结构排序算法11-29
我为妈妈点个赞作文800字05-13
2022年山西忻州忻府区招聘大学生村官公告【8月2日8:00网络报名启动】08-02
美国EB-5投资移民相关的纳税常识07-22
普通话推广活动总结(精选12篇)09-20
我战胜了胆怯作文700字01-23
2021年上海静安初级会计职称考试时间为5月15日至19日、5月22日至23日 10-10
幼儿园安全教育教案《交通安全伴我行》5篇03-26
幼儿园教育笔记范例集锦【五篇】08-05
七十岁寿宴主持词开场白08-25